Main Office
491 Humphrey St, Swampscott, MA 01907-2618
(781) 598-1260
We Are Here
Real Estate Management in Swampscott, Massachusetts
Main Office
491 Humphrey St, Swampscott, MA 01907-2618
(781) 598-1260
Copyright © 2025 WebForCompany.com. All rights reserved.